    Hello,

    Please lower your VOX intercom sensitivity to level 1, as this should help reduce the issue. Alternatively, try relocating your mic further away and tucking it into your helmet's cheek pad to help mitigate input volume.

    That sounds super frustrating, especially when it keeps interrupting your music. After an update, it’s pretty common for the VOX sensitivity or voice command settings to get reset or cranked up too high. I’d go into the Sena app or device settings and try lowering or disabling VOX/voice activation entirely to see if that fixes it. A full reset to factory settings and re-pairing your devices can also clear out weird post-update bugs. If nothing changes, it might be worth reinstalling the firmware or contacting Sena support, because this definitely isn’t normal behavior.
